Company Summary

The Company designs tidal-current generating systems for state waters in the SE; the electricity will be sold to utility companies to meet RPSs. It includes patented rotor design (7.736,127 and 8,100,648), MP controlling rotor direction and pitch (2012-0114483), and hydraulic drive-train (8,106,527) which places generator ground level. Tidal and wind turbines at same site using hydraulic drive-trains and accumulators synchronize production/use.
